Testimony of a Holocaust Survivor from Holland, presented by the Paul Peck Humanities Institute

Robert F. Teitel, an orphaned child Holocaust survivor born in Amsterdam, Holland, will narrate the history of his extended family in relation to major developments of the 20th Century: “ massive” demographic migrations, World War I, the rise of Nazism, World War II, the Holocaust, and post-war dislocations.

His presentation traces the movement of different branches of the family from Eastern to Western Europe, to the Middle East, and to the United States. With great relevance to contemporary issues, Mr. Teitel speaks to the deadly consequences of allowing extremist ideologies, such as anti-Semitism, to thrive and to the challenges faced by refugees in striving to escape war-ravaged regions.
